    Why China is Perfect for Friends'Getaways

    China's immense diversity ensures there's something for everyone. Urbanexplorers can immerse themselves in the dynamic energy of cities like Beijing,Shanghai, and Guangzhou, while nature lovers can find serenity in the karstlandscapes of Yangshuo or the towering peaks of Zhangjiajie. History buffs willappreciate the ancient wonders such as the Forbidden City, the Terracotta Army,and traditional water towns. The country's efficient transportation network,including high-speed trains, makes it easy for groups to explore multipledestinations during their trip.

    Exciting Friends Package Activities in China

    One of the standout features of friendstrips to China is the variety of activities tailored for groupenjoyment. Adventure enthusiasts can trek the wild sections of the Great Wall,go horseback riding on the grasslands of Inner Mongolia, or take a thrillingcable car ride to Huangshan (Yellow Mountain).

    Groups interested in cultural immersion can enjoy cooking classes tomaster dishes like kung pao chicken, explore traditional markets, or attend alive acrobatics show in Shanghai. Historical tours of Xi'an's ancient citywalls and the Terracotta Army, paired with a visit to a Tang Dynasty culturalperformance, offer a deep dive into China's past.

    For nature lovers, a cruise along the Yangtze River, a visit to the riceterraces of Longsheng, or exploring the dramatic landscapes of ZhangjiajieNational Forest Park offers serene and awe-inspiring experiences. Seasonalactivities, such as visiting Harbin's Ice and Snow Festival in winter orexploring the blossoming fields in Luoping during spring, provide a uniquetouch to your trip.

    In bustling urban centers, your group can enjoy modern experiences likeshopping in Shanghai's Nanjing Road, nightlife in Guangzhou, or a scenicevening cruise on the Pearl River. For something more relaxed, a tea-drinkingsession in a traditional tea house or a stroll through Beijing's historicalleyways provides opportunities to unwind while soaking in the local culture.
